"Asbestos was the main cause of occupational ill health in the 20th century"
Past Exposure to Asbestos kills over 3000 people a year in Great Britain. This number is expected to go on rising for the next 10 years. Up to 500,000 commercial, industrial and public buildings in the UK are likely to contain asbestos materials. To tackle this, legislation has been brought in since 2004 to attempt to reduce exposure to asbestos fibres through the concept of discovery and management of asbestos in non-residential buildings.
As asbestos was not fully banned until 1999, premises could still contain asbestos and there are over 2,000 recognised building products which contain asbestos, ranging from insulations through to toilet seats.

It is the owner's / occupier's responsibility under the The Control of Asbestos Regulations 2006 act to:
- Find out whether the building contains asbestos and determine what condition it is in.
- Assess the risk, e.g. if it is likely to release fibres.
- Make a plan to manage that risk.
